Medical animation involves the use of visual media to depict complex medical, biological, or anatomical concepts through 2D, 3D, or interactive graphics. It is widely used for educational, training, and marketing purposes in healthcare settings, helping to improve understanding, communication, and engagement among patients, healthcare professionals, and students.
The main types of medical animations include 3D animation, 2D animation, real-time imaging (4D animation), and flash animation. 3D medical animation involves creating three-dimensional, computer-generated visuals to represent medical concepts, processes, and conditions with high detail and realism. Key therapeutic areas for these animations include oncology, cardiology, cosmeceuticals/plastic surgery, and dental care, among others. Applications of medical animation include explaining drug mechanisms of action (MOA), patient education, surgical training and planning, and cellular and molecular studies. These animations are used by various end users such as life science companies, medical device manufacturers, hospitals, surgical centers, clinics, and academic institutions.

The medical animation market size has grown exponentially in recent years. It will grow from $0.5 billion in 2024 to $0.61 billion in 2025 at a compound annual growth rate (CAGR) of 21.7%. The growth in the historic period can be attributed to rise in demand for patient education tools, growth in pharmaceutical marketing efforts, increased use of e-learning in medical training, growth in prevalence of chronic diseases, and rise in awareness about scientific visualization in healthcare.
The medical animation market size is expected to see exponential growth in the next few years. It will grow to $1.34 billion in 2029 at a compound annual growth rate (CAGR) of 21.8%. The growth in the forecast period can be attributed to expansion of telemedicine and virtual consultations, growing investments in healthcare communication tools, adoption of AR and VR technologies in medical education, rising government support for medical animations, and demand for personalized healthcare visualizations. Major trends in the forecast period include collaboration between animation studios and healthcare providers, integration of blockchain for secure animation content, development of multilingual animation solutions, integration of AI in animation production, and advancements in 3d and 4d animation technologies.

The increasing adoption of telemedicine and virtual consultations is anticipated to drive the medical animation market in the future. Telemedicine involves using digital communication tools to provide healthcare remotely, allowing patients and providers to interact without being physically present. The rise in virtual consultations is attributed to technological progress, better internet access, and the growing demand for more accessible healthcare. Medical animation plays a crucial role in enhancing telemedicine and virtual consultations by visually explaining complex medical concepts, procedures, and conditions in an easy-to-understand and engaging manner. This helps patients gain a clearer understanding of their diagnosis, treatment options, and the overall care process, improving communication, engagement, and satisfaction during remote healthcare interactions. For example, in 2022, the Australian Digital Health Agency reported that 118.2 million telehealth services were provided to 18 million patients, with over 95,000 practitioners using telehealth services. Therefore, the growth of telemedicine and virtual consultations is expected to fuel the medical animation market.
Companies in the medical animation market are focusing on technological innovations, such as holographic real-time 3D (RT3D) models, to enhance the realism and interactivity of visual content, providing more immersive and accurate depictions of medical procedures, anatomy, and disease mechanisms. This advancement aims to improve patient education, surgical planning, and medical training. Holographic RT3D models are interactive, three-dimensional digital representations that simulate realistic visuals and behaviors, often presented in a holographic format for a more immersive experience. For example, in November 2022, GigXR, a US-based provider of extended reality (XR) solutions for healthcare training, partnered with ANIMA RES, a German medical imaging company, to launch the Insight Series. This new content library includes RT3D holographic models of organs such as the lungs, heart, and kidneys, showcasing the structural and functional changes caused by diseases such as myocardial infarction and chronic obstructive pulmonary disease (COPD).
In June 2022, The Lockwood Group, a US-based company specializing in medical communications and healthcare services, acquired Random42, a UK-based medical animation studio, from Graphite Capital. The acquisition aims to strengthen Lockwood Group's medical communications and healthcare services portfolio by incorporating Random42's expertise in high-quality medical animation and 3D visualization. This expansion enhances their ability to create scientifically accurate and engaging visual content for the pharmaceutical, biotechnology, and healthcare industries, ultimately improving client offerings in scientific communication, patient education, and marketing.
